WebMay 11, 2008 · So one Minute of angle at 500 yards exactly 5.236 inches. Many simply say 1 inch per hundred yards and 5 inches at 5 hundred yards and this is fine until it is compounded. example if one needs 25 minutes of angle correction at 1,000 yards that is a correction of 261.8 inches. WebMar 30, 2024 · In the American system of measurement, a click is 0.62 miles. The exact history of the term “click,” or “klick,” as one more often sees it spelled, is unknown. American soldiers first became familiar with its use during the Vietnam Era. Many believe the term originated in Europe as a sort of shorthand way to say “kilometer.”
